
Many 'apes' on Reddit are sitting out the Robinhood IPO
CNN
Robinhood's initial public offering is arguably the most eagerly awaited of the year. But according to commentary on Reddit, it's one of the least popular for some traders.
There appear to be a lot of angry individual investors — the so-called apes of Reddit — who want nothing to do with the company or the stock.
